Large numbers of Americans fear that President Donald Trump’s import tariffs policy will result in negative consequences for the United States, a new PEW Research Center poll showed on Thursday.

“Overall, nearly half (49%) of U.S. adults say increased tariffs between the U.S. and its trading partners will be bad for the country.

“A smaller share (40%) say the tariffs will be good for the US, while 11 percent say they don’t know how the tariffs will affect the country.

“In addition, talk of tariffs and trade wars has registered widely with the public, with 82 per cent reporting they are paying attention to the debate over trade,’’ the release said.

According to the release, as with most issues in contemporary U.S. politics, opinions break along party lines, with 73 percent of Republicans and Republican-leaning independents approving of Trump’s approach to trade.

This was compared with 77 percent of Democrats and Democratic leaners who are opposed.
